CCTV image released of man police want to speak to
Police are hunting a man who exposed themselves to a woman in Tunbridge Wells.
The victim, a woman in her 30s, was walking on Calverly Road at 2.15am on January 26.
The man didn’t touch the victim, but made lewd comments towards her.
Police have now released a CCTV image of a man they want to talk to in connection with the incident.
The suspect is described as a white man, of around 50-years-old who was wearing a blue coat, dark trousers and a brown belt.
Anyone who may recognise the man in the picture or who witnessed the incident is asked to contact Kent police on 01892 502012 or Kent Crimestoppers on 0800 555 111 quoting crime reference YY/1686/12.
